Original price at sale: $129,000.

DRAGON FIRE Description

one-of-a-kind pistol featuring hand engraved dragon motif and stippling by FEGA Master Engraver Lee Griffiths, .45 ACP cal., stainless steel construction, slide with polished fangs fore of the dust cover and a pair of "eyes" containing jet black Marquis Cut diamond pupils surrounded by 24 rubies on each rearward side, genuine ruby front sight, custom handmade rear sight, serial no. "Dragon1911". New 2021.
